Question

Fill in the blanks:
(i) There are ________ groups and ________ periods in the modern form of periodic table.
(ii) Most electropositive elements belong to _________ group.
(iii) Most electronegative elements belong to ________ group.
(iv) Energy released when electron is added to a neutral gaseous atom is called ________.
(v) Size of the atoms ________ from left to right across a period and _________ on descending in a group of normal elements.
(vi) The maximum electronegativity is shown by _________.
(vii) Noble gases have __________ electron affinity.

Open in App
Solution

(i) There are 18 groups and 7 periods in the modern form of periodic table.
(ii) Most electropositive elements belong to the first group.
(iii) Most electronegative elements belong to the seventeenth group.
(iv) Energy released when electron is added to a neutral gaseous atom is called electron affinity.
(v) Size of the atoms decreases from left to right across a period and increases on descending in a group of normal elements.
(vi) The maximum electronegativity is shown by fluorine.
(vii) Noble gases have zero electron affinity.
